LI Tingting
Research Assistant Professor
litt@sustech.edu.cn

Tingting Li, Research Assistant Professor in the Department of Biomedical Engineering of Southern University of Science and Technology (SUSTech). She received the Ph.D. degree from SUSTech in 2023. Her main research interests include the fast, large-field-of-view, and high-resolution photoacoustic imaging technologies, the multi-modal optical imaging systems, and optical imaging in clinical applications. To date, she has published 24 SCI-indexed papers in internationally renowned journals such as Nature Communications, Laser & Photonics Reviews, Optics Letters, Advanced Functional Materials, Advanced Science, and Biomedical Optics Express, including 11  first-author or corresponding-author publications. She has applied and granted 4 patents.

She has chaired the Young Scientists Fund Project (C) of the National Natural Science Foundation of China and Doctoral Scientific Research Staring Foundation by Shenzhen Science and Technology Innovation Committee. Additionally, she serves as a key member or core participant in 7 research projects.
